Seen the Free Hugs in Tokyo for many a moon now but this was the first time I saw "Free Toss" where they toss you in the air.
In Japanese this is known as "Dou-age" [胴上げ] (pronounced "Door-ageh"). Folks visiting from the UK however may get the wrong idea about a "free toss" - "tossing" in London slang means to wax ones dolphin...

Related facts 1: In Cantonese, waxing the dolphin is also for some reason referred to as "hitting the aeroplane."

Related Facts 2: The Japanese word for waxing the dolphin is known as Onani [オナニー] which according to wikipedia comes from the German word Onanie meaning the same thing. I think its the same word in Korean too.

          The term onanism (also used in English) actually comes from a story in the bible. In it the christian god kills a man calles Onan, because he doesn't want to concieve a child with his dead brother's widow, (The god also killed his brother btw.) but rather "spills his seed on the ground".

    I can't say much about the tosses, but there was a social experiment done with "Free Hugs" before.
    It was about how people don't interact with each other nowadays, and giving away hugs was to help people brighten their day even if by a little.
    It showed how so many people thought it was weird to receive a hug from a stranger, and you would see many people walk away from the huggers with a strange look on their faces. It also shows how even strangers could give each other hugs and brighten each other's day.
    The campaign at one point got banned by the local authorities and they had to gather people and create a petition to continue to give out Free Hugs.
